Overview

There’s nothing like the smell and taste of fresh homemadebread. But who has the time to make it anymore? You do—with alittle help from your automatic bread machine. All bread machinescan make good bread; they just need a little help from you to turnout a good loaf. With a little practice and a lot of fun, you toocan make freshly baked bread in your kitchen with the touch of abutton.

Bread Machines For Dummies is for anyone who has everbeen frustrated by a bread machine and wants to know if it’sreally possible to turn out great bread with a minimum of time andeffort (it is!). This fun and easy guide shares simple techniquesand more than 85 tested, foolproof recipes for making aromatic andflavorful breads—either for your bread machine or from doughthat you shape yourself and bake in the oven. You’ll see howto make:

  • Soft white bread
  • Cracked wheat bread
  • Basic danish dough
  • Babka and C hallah
  • Bread bowls
  • Bread sticks, pizza, and focaccia
  • And so much more!

This handy resource guide provides everything you“knead” to know about making bread, including the bestingredients to use, how to work with dough, and how to get the bestresults out of your machine. Along with plenty of cooking,measuring, and shopping tips, you get expert advice on how to:

  • Shape simple doughs into beautiful breads
  • Mix flours and liquids for perfect bread texture
  • Adapt machine recipes for two loaf sizes
  • Understand the different wheat flours
  • Fit bread into a gluten-free diet
  • Avoid moisture mistakes
  • Make breads with alternative ingredients such as rice flour,potato starch, and tapioca flour
Featuring a cheat sheet with standard measuring equivalents andtemperature conversions, tips for troubleshooting your machine, anddelicious recipes for such tasty delights as Cheddar Cheese CornBread, Pecan Sticky Rolls, Cranberry Nut Bread, and Banana LemonLoaf, Bread Machines For Dummies reveals the best ways tobake, store, and enjoy your bread!

This book title, Bread Machines For Dummies, ISBN: 9780764552410, by Glenna Vance, Tom Lacalamita, published by Wiley (November 6, 2000) is available in paperback.
